    Position Overview
    Ralph Lauren is seeking a Digital Photography Technician for our digital studio in Long Island City, NY.

    The Digital Technician will join a team of photographers and digital technicians, working closely with a team of stylists and product coordinators in a fast-paced, high volume, studio environment.

    The DT primarily handles on-set file workflow in Capture One, color corrections, file outputs, as well as traditional Photo Assistant duties such as set setup and teardown, and camera setup.

    The DT will also be called upon to assist in some post-production responsibilities in regards to file management (but not retouching).

    This position has a close working relationship with photographers and art directors and requires a positive on-set presence.
